ADHD Assessment Edinburgh - Getting a Diagnosis Online
GPs can refer adults for an ADHD assessment and treatment, but this is usually a long process. Many adults prefer to go private.
It is beneficial to ensure that the person seeking an ADHD assessment can bring supporting evidence like school reports or questionnaires. They should also have someone who can corroborate their symptoms, ideally an adult friend or family member.

If you're experiencing difficulties with attention, concentration or organizational abilities it could be time to get an adult ADHD assessment.
There are a variety of clinics that provide private ADHD assessments. Most of these clinics will allow you to book your appointment online or by phone. Some will also require you to send in supporting evidence before the assessment, for example, school reports and previous diagnoses. These documents can be submitted in advance of the appointment or brought on the day of the examination.
Many private assessments consist of psychometric tests and observations, in addition to the clinical interview. They will also provide the complete report. This will help you to understand your strengths and weaknesses and provide recommendations for treatment. In some cases the treatment could include therapy or medication.
